Overview

The Digital Acoustics IP7-FX is a versatile IP (Internet Protocol) 2-way audio
module with an integrated 8-watt amplifier, call button, relay, sensor and 2-
port network switch. It is designed to replace the older IP7-ST/STx
SS8, IP7-SE8 and the IP7-FD model IP audio modules and can support:
Full duplex audio with echo cancellation
Half duplex audio using a separate mic and speaker
Half duplex audio using the speaker as both a speaker and microphone
Paging only audio using one or more 8 Ohm speakers
Paging only audio using an analog amplifier which is connected to
multiple speakers
With this flexible design the IP7-FX can be used in a variety of applications
where network-based audio is required.
Standard features of the IP7-FX include:
Pluggable DIN connectors to facilitate wiring
connections
Flexible analog audio device options
Highly scalable, seamless expansion
Mounting via rail or surface mount
Fixed or DHCP compliant IP assignment
Powered via external 12VDC or PoE (802.3af)
Integrated 2-port switch
Field upgradeable firmware
